KAVANAGH, MARTIN - The Assiniboine Basin - a Social Study of Discovery, Exploration and Settlement: With Many Illustrations and Maps

Manitoba: Self-Published / Public Press Ltd, 1946. First Edition. Hardcover. 282 pages. Index. Black and white photographic plates. Two fold-out maps. "The author has selected Brandon, a typical Assinniboine basin city, to illustrate civic development on the prairies." - from Preface. Prior owner's name and date upon front free endpaper. Binding intact. Average wear. A sound copy of this informative work.
